Review: My girlfriend had taken our used 2006 Honda Pilot we had bought from this dealer 1 year ago in for a routine oil change, as we have oil change coupons when we purchased it. As she was waiting for the service to be completed she then was notified that there was an issue with the oil plug/ oil pan and would need to have the oil pan replaced or the oil will leak out. We have never had this vehicle serviced anywhere else and this has been the third time having them service the vehicle. They had talked my girlfriend who is not listed as an owner into giving permission to perform the work because she would not be able to drive the car. After I found out about the situation, I asked to speak to the manager who was in my opinion ignorant of the situation and claim they are not responsible. I was given the opportunity to look at the oil pan and plug and seen the damaged threads. I was told by the manager that this is common with Honda's with high mileage. I don't believe that is the case, I believe the threads were accidentally stripped from over tightening or cross threaded by the mechanic. I brought that up to the manager and he attested that is not possible with their mechanic with over 30 years of experience. I asked several mechanics at the company where I work and they had also said the only way the threads could of been damaged would be from over tightening or cross threading, it would not just happen because the vehicle has high mileage.

The manager also stated that the vehicle was leaking oil when it came in to the shop but there were no signs of oil spots on our driveway where it is always parked.

We were also never offered to repair the threads by using a tap, or drilling the drain hole larger and tapping new threads and installing a larger plug. (there are repair kits for this by Honda)

I had also took out a 2 year service plan on the vehicle (additional $2,300) which is supposed to cover the engine, transmission and drive train which is what I was told but the oil pan was not specifically listed as a covered item nor listed as a excluded item, and was notified that it's not covered. They do list valve covers which I don't understand??

The previous time we had taken the vehicle for an oil change a wheel stud was broke off which they did take care of and replaced it.

This simple oil change which was prepaid from the purchase of the vehicle costed us $241.00 and I truly feel they are responsible for the damages.

I feel this dealership is taking advantage of us and would not want other people to have a similar situation which might be more costly than this. This is more about the principle than the money.Desired Settlement: Refund for the entire cost of replacement of the oil pan.

Review: I purchased a 2012 Nissan Juke SV on May 20, 2014 at the Boucher Nissan of Waukesha. I was under the impression that the final purchase price would be around 20,000$ after tax, title and license. I made it very clear several times I did not want to finance the vehicle through there financial department. Eventually, they pressured me into financing through them and claimed to have given me the same interest rate that my personal bank would give me (6%). So, I agreed to finance through them because they managed to give me the same rate. They gave me an interest rate of 6.99% that I hadn't realized until my first payment when [redacted] sent me a account information statement. I feel they should have told me outright that it was more like a 7% interest rate. But to make the sale they embellished immensely.

I then was told my car comes with a 100,000 mile bumper to bumper warranty. They did not verbally disclose that it was an additional 3,249.00. When I called to cancel my warranty they lied and told me I had to drive to the dealership to do so (2 hours away). This is not true. I can have a dealership that is local verify the mileage and have the notarized paperwork mailed in. This is just the second occurrence where they have been insensitive to my requests and making their commission is the ONLY importance at this dealership.

Another issue with this vehicle purchase is the sales associate failed to mention that the car had been in an accident in 2013 in the state of [redacted]. When I asked for vehicle history I received a [redacted] buyback guarantee, but not once did he reveal the actual report. This makes the trade in and/retail value significantly lower.

A third problem I have with this sale is the sales associate insisted on the Etch Protection that I did not ask for. However, they said that it comes with the Auto Armor package. BUT it does NOT. It was an additional 1204.00 more on the credit contract.

I feel that this dealership took advantage of me when buying this vehicle. I have called to cancel my warranty they lied and told me I had to drive to the dealership to do so. This is not true. I can have a dealership that is local verify the mileage and have the notarized paperwork mailed in. They have been insensitive to my requests and making their commission is the ONLY importance at this dealership.Desired Settlement: That for future reference they will treat people with the respect they deserve. It is a business and money is an important aspect, however, I will consider buying from this dealership again when they right their wrong and compensate me for the losses I will encounter during resale/trade in.
